Quordle answer today: what the four boards usually demand first

The answers above are the quick check for July 30, 2026, but Quordle rarely falls apart because one word is impossible. It usually falls apart because one early guess helps only one board while the other three stay vague.

That is why the opening matters more here than in a single-grid game. Every guess needs to carry two jobs: make progress on the easiest board and pull information from the stubborn ones.

How to split attention without losing the board

A board that looks almost solved can trick you into spending a whole turn for one clean finish. Sometimes that is right. Often it is not. If another board is still foggy, the stronger guess is the one that keeps both boards moving.

Quordle rewards balanced pressure. A clean solve usually comes from staying useful everywhere until one board becomes impossible to ignore.

Which guesses are actually worth the risk

Good Quordle guesses test structure, not just letters. If two boards are both hinting at common endings, a well-chosen probe can settle both at once. If the boards are pulling in different directions, the guess should cover the leftover unknowns rather than chase a lucky finish.

The common mistake is panicking once one board looks awkward. That is the moment to widen information again, not to swing harder at the same half-solved pattern.

How to finish tomorrow's Quordle with fewer scrambles

Think in pairs. Which board is nearly solved, and which board can benefit from the same probe word? That question usually saves more guesses than trying to clear the prettiest grid first.
